当前位置: 首页 > 专利查询>微软公司专利>正文

知晓上下文的客户端应用程序制造技术

技术编号:4601670 阅读:168 留言:0更新日期:2012-04-11 18:40
描述了用于经由内容和广告收益来补贴网络接入的技术和过程。在一个实现中,用户在该用户的计算设备上安装了上下文栏工具。为了接入网络(例如无线网络),用户激活该上下文栏工具并请求接入到诸如因特网等网络。网络服务提供商检测到该上下文栏工具并向用户提供网络接入。内容和广告服务收集内容和广告并用该内容和广告填充显示在用户设备上的上下文栏图形界面。内容和广告的提供商为这一展示付费并因此生成能用于抵消提供网络接入及其它网络服务的成本的收益。

【技术实现步骤摘要】
【国外来华专利技术】知晓上下文的客户端应用程序扭旦 冃眾无线设备迅速增加,这种激增随之带来了相应的对接入无线网络的需求。虽 然当前有许多无线网络存在,但是无线用户可以接入这些网络所涉及的条款是成问 题的,因为无线用户通常需要便宜或者免费的方式接入无线网络和因特网。这就给 无线网络服务的提供商提出了问题,因为建立和维护无线网络需要真实的成本。为 了回收这些成本,许多无线网络服务的提供商对用户收取接入费以及对不愿意支付 接入费的潜在用户提供有限的接入或者不提供接入。认为这些接入条款不合乎需要 的无线用户会选择不接入这些特定网络。概述本申请描述了通过内容和广告收益来补贴网络接入的技术和过程。在一个实 现中,用户在其计算设备上安装了上下文栏工具。为接入网络(例如无线网络), 用户激活该上下文栏工具并请求接入诸如因特网等网络。网络服务提供商检测到该 上下文栏工具并向用户提供网络接入。内容和广告服务收集内容和广告并用这些内 容和广告填充显示在用户设备上的上下文栏图形界面。内容和广告的提供商为这一展示付费并因此产生收益,该收益可用于抵消提供网络接入和其它网络服务的成 本。提供这一概述是为了以一种简单的方式介绍在下面的详细描述中将进一步描 述概念的选集。这一概述不旨在标识所要求保护的主题的关键特征或必要特征,也 不旨在用来帮助确定所要求保护的主题的范围。附图简述参考附图描述详细描述。在附图中,参考标号的最左边数字指示这个参考标 号首次出现的附图。在不同附图中使用相同的参考标号指示类似或同样的项。 附图说明图1示出了用户能够使用上下文栏工具接入网络的示例性体系结构。5图2示出了允许网络服务提供商为用户代理网络连接的示例性检测服务模块。 图3示出了向在用户设备上显示的上下文栏界面提供内容和广告的示例性上 下文服务器。图4示出了具有示例性上下文栏界面的示例性用户设备显示。 图5是用于为用户代理网络连接的示例性过程的流程图。 图6是用于确保上下文栏工具在用户设备上保持活动的示例性过程的流程图。 图7是用于使用上下文相关的内容和广告填充上下文栏界面的示例性过程的 流程图。图8是用于创建用户简档令牌并使用该用户简档令牌来收集上下文相关的内 容和广告的示例性过程的流程图。图9是用于基于内容和广告展示来收集收益的示例性过程的流程图。详细描述这些所描述的过程和技术使用有针对性的广告和内容来抵消提供网络服务的 成本。通过广告和内容产生的收益被网络服务提供商共享,作为向某些网络用户提 供打折或免费的网络接入的交换。为利用打折或免费的网络接入,预期用户在其无 线设备上运行上下文栏工具。上下文栏工具以图形用户界面的形式向用户呈现上下 文栏,该图形用户界面在用户的无线设备上显示广告和内容以及其它事物。通过上 下文栏获得展示的广告客户和内容提供商为这一服务付费并因此产生抵消网络服 务成本的收益。然而,这并非是限制性的,并且可以在不给内容提供商增加额外成 本的情况下在内容栏上显示内容。示例性体系结构图1示出了能够实现所描述的过程和技术的体系结构100。体系结构100包括 计算设备102、网络104和上下文栏服务器106。计算设备102可被配置为通过网 络104接入开放式网络。开放式网络的一个示例是因特网,也称为万维网或者 web。尽管作为笔记本计算机或者膝上型计算机来示出,但是计算设备102可 以实现为各种常规计算设备中的任一种,这些常规计算设备包括例如台式计算机、 工作站、大型计算机、移动通信设备、PDA、娱乐设备、机顶盒、因特网装置、游戏控制台等等。计算设备102还包括存储器108。存储器108包括例如是随机存储 器(RAM)的易失性存储器形式和/或例如是只读存储器(ROM)或闪存的非易失 性存储器形式的计算机可读介质。存储器108通常包括可由处理器112立即存取和 /或当前正由处理器112操作的、用于实现上下文栏工具110的数据和/或程序模块。 存储器108还包括web浏览器114。输入/输出设备116 (例如键盘和鼠标)以及可 在操作上将包括处理器112在内的各种组件耦合到存储器108的系统总线(未示出) 也作为计算设备102的一部分来包括。网络104可以是有线网络、无线网络或者它们的组合。网络104还可以是各个 单独网络的集合,这些单独网络相互连接并作为单个大型网络来运作(例如因特网 或内联网)。这样的单独网络的示例包括但不限于局域网(LAN)、广域网(WAN)、 城域网(MAN)、蜂窝网络、卫星网络以及电缆网络。在一个示例中,计算设备102的用户想要连接开放式网络(例如因特网)。作 为连接过程的一部分,无线组件118检测网络104并向该网络发送连接请求。无线 组件118是具有使计算设备102能够发送和/或接收无线信号的能力的任何设备。 网络服务提供商122上的无线设备120接收这一请求。无线设备120是能够接收和 发射无线信号的设备,例如是无线保真(下文中称为WiFi)路由器、无线接 入点(WAP)、或能够发送和接收无线数据信号的任何其它设备。网络服务提供 商122是创建和/或维护管理网络104的全部或部分所必需的物理组件的实体(例 如是因特网服务提供商)。无线设备120向检测服务124传达接收到了连接请求。检测服务124向计算设 备102査询以确定计算设备102的订户状态。在一个示例中,网络服务提供商122 提供不同级别的订户服务。一些订户支付一笔订费以获取特定级别的网络接入的资 格(例如特定连接带宽或级别的开放式网络接入能力)。其他订户在他们的计算设 备上安装上下文栏工具110,则这使他们获取了特定级别的网络接入的资格。上下文栏工具110能安装在计算设备上并用来使用户能通过在他们设备上激 活(即运行)这一工具来接入网络。上下文栏工具110包括实现上下文栏工具的功 能以及允许在计算设备上显示上下文相关的内容和广告的多个组件和模块。在此使 用的术语模块和/或组件通常表示软件、固件或软件和固件的组合。上下 文栏工具110的组件和模块包括内容模块126—这个模块被配置成接收和存储用户会认为相关的内容以及其它信息(例如与用户在web浏览器114上观看的内容在上下文上相关的信息)。 该内容和其它信息能够从例如上下文栏服务器106等外部实体接收。该内容可以包 括如网站、博客等web内容和引起用户兴趣的其他信息。上下文相关性部分地基 于用户简档信息,例如用户的年龄、地理位置、工作领域、兴趣爱好等等。如下所 述,上下文相关性也能通过用户访问的网站类型以及用户在web搜索会话期间输 入的搜索项的类型来确定。广告模块128—这个模块是使用与观看者的简档和/或用户正在观看的网页内 容在上下文上相关的广告来进行填充的。搜索模块130—这个模块允许用户使用上下文栏工具执行搜索,而且也可以返 回匹配用户简档和/或与用户正在观看的内容在上下文上相关的搜索结果。当用户 在他们的浏览器中使用任一其他搜索引擎执行搜索时,这个模块也能够使得上下文 栏工具提供来自预定搜索引擎的搜索结果。简档模块132_这个模块是使用关于用户的、外部实体(例如上下文栏服务器 106)可访问的简档数据来进行填充的。这个模块也确定用户的当前上下文,例如 物理位置、日期和时间以及用户正在观看的内容和/本文档来自技高网...

【技术保护点】
一种方法,包括: 从设备接收对接入网络的许可的请求(504); 确定一应用程序是否在所述设备上运行(514),所述应用程序被配置成显示与所述设备的用户的网络导航行为在上下文上相关的数据(404);以及 如果所述应用程序在所 述设备上运行,则向所述设备授予接入所述网络的许可(508)。

【技术特征摘要】
【国外来华专利技术】US 2007-5-25 11/754,1051、一种方法,包括从设备接收对接入网络的许可的请求(504);确定一应用程序是否在所述设备上运行(514),所述应用程序被配置成显示与所述设备的用户的网络导航行为在上下文上相关的数据(404);以及如果所述应用程序在所述设备上运行,则向所述设备授予接入所述网络的许可(508)。2、 如权利要求1所述的方法,其特征在于,所述应用程序包括通知网络服务提供商所述应用程序正在所述设备上运行的接入控制模块。3、 如权利要求l所述的方法,其特征在于,所述应用程序被配置成捕捉标识所述用户导航到的网络位置的标识符;以及至少部分地基于所述标识符,在所述设备上显示与所述网络位置在上下文上相关的数据。4、 如权利要求1所述的方法,其特征在于,还包括创建包括有关所述设备的用户的信息的用户简档令牌;使用所述用户简档令牌来收集内容;以及使用所述应用程序在所述设备上显示所述内容。5、 如权利要求1所述的方法,其特征在于,还包括如果所述应用程序没有在所述设备上运行,则确定所述应用程序是否安装在所述设备上;以及如果所述应用程序没有安装在所述设备上,则将所述设备定向到允许该设备安装该应用程序的网络位置。6、 如权利要求1所述的方法,其特征在于,如果所述应用程序没有在所述设备上运行,入的许可。7、 如权利要求1所述的方法,其特征在于,如果所述应用程序没有在所述设备上运行,的许可。8、 如权利要求1所述的方法,其特征在于,还包括还包括则向该设备授予受限制的网络接还包括则对所述设备拒绝接入所述网络如果所述应用程序没有在所述设备上运行,则将所述设备定向到允许该设备安装该应用程序并启动该应用程序的网络位置。9、 一种系统,包括上下文应用程序(110),其中所述上下文应用程序被配置成将设备导航到的一个或多个网络位置记录在日志中(704);接收与所述网络位置相关的上下文数据(710);以及检测服务,所述检测服务检测上下文应用程序活动并至少部分地基于该上下文...

【专利技术属性】
技术研发人员:SD维茨MJ迈尔斯PJ罗伊
申请(专利权)人:微软公司
类型:发明
国别省市:US[美国]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1